What to Do the Moment You Discover Bed Bugs

Waking up with red itchy bumps on your skin is alarming. These bites look like flea bites or mosquito bites but appear in lines. Bed bugs are attracted to carbon dioxide and feed on human blood or animal blood at night. Check your sleeping areas right away.

Look for reddish brown, flat, oval shaped bugs about 10mm long, roughly apple seed size. They hide in harborage zones like mattress seams and tight hiding spots. A confirmed infestation spreads fast, so act before it grows. Seal off that room immediately.

Ontario Tenant Rights and Landlord Obligations for Bed Bugs

Under the Residential Tenancies Act, your landlord must fix a pest infestation in your rental unit. Toronto Municipal Code Chapter 629 also enforces strict property standards for every building. Tell the landlord right away that writing a text or email works as legal proof. This protects you fully.

A landlord must hire a licensed professional pest control operator to treat a multiple unit dwelling. The Canadian Pest Management Association sets the standards these exterminators follow in Ontario. As a tenant, follow all preparation instructions your exterminator gives before treatment. A public health officer or building management can step in if bed bug related issues go ignored in Toronto.

Bed Bug Removal Process Step by Step

Step 1 Systematic Inspection of All Harborage Zones

Start every job with a systematic inspection of all harborage zones. Check mattress seams, mattress tufts, mattress folds, box spring seams, and box spring interior. Pull back the dust cover and look under bed slats and inside the bed frame. Scan the headboard front and back, both nightstands, every side table, and each lamp base near bedrooms. Run your flashlight along baseboards around bed and peek inside electrical sockets around bed. Step 2 Preparation Before Any Treatment

Preparation decides how well the treatment works. Declutter every surface first empty drawers, closets, and open surfaces completely. Seal all clothing, linens, mattress pads, bedding, bed skirts, infested clothes, and curtains inside sealed plastic bags. Launder in hot water and run the dryer on the hottest setting for 30 minutes minimum. Take dry clean only items and non washable items to a cleaner right away. Remove items in bags directly, never shake them open inside the home.

Step 4 Post Treatment Monitoring Protocol

Post treatment monitoring stops a comeback before it starts. Run weekly inspections first month across all previously infested areas. Look for live bugs, fecal stains, moulted skins, and blood spots during every visual inspection. Move to bi-weekly inspections next few months once no signs of bed bug activity appear. A localized infestation caught early needs only reapplication or one round of further treatment. Early catch skips full reassessment and identification and saves real money.

Long Term Prevention Tips for Bed Bugs

Ongoing Home Protocols

Vacuum regularly using a HEPA filter vacuum along seams crevices baseboards every week. Wash bedding hot water and wash clothing hot water as a fixed routine. Fit a mattress encasement and box spring cover using certified covers that trap existing bugs and prevent new infestations. Place passive interceptor monitors under every bed leg cup to catch hitchhikers early.

Second Hand Furniture and Travel Protocols

Inspect used furniture from any antique shop or garage sale before bringing second hand items before bringing inside. Wipe dirty spots with an alcohol soaked cotton swab a reddish brown smear indicates bed bug droppings. Hotels notorious for harbouring bed bugs so run a full hotel room inspection on arrival. Check, inspect mattress seams, inspect bed frames, watch for tiny red eggs and dark spots. Bed bugs are easily transported through luggage, clothing, and used bedding via tiny crevices that facilitate movement place to place.

Structural Sealing for Condos and Apartments

Shared walls in any condo or apartment let bugs travel from adjacent units without warning. Seal cracks, seal gaps, and seal crevices around electrical outlets, baseboards, gaps in walls, gaps in floors, and gaps around utility pipes. Apply powder insecticide in wall cavities, electrical conduits, and plumbing chases to block movement through wall cavities. This stops bugs crossing from adjacent apartments, attached houses, and other condo units in any multi unit dwelling.

Do I have to throw away my mattress?

No. Bed bugs live on the surface and seams, not inside. A certified mattress encasement traps existing bugs and blocks new ones. Vacuum seams and crevices thoroughly before encasing.
